The Implant Treatment Refine
Recognizing the implant treatment process is important for elders considering this oral option. The journey usually begins with an examination where your dental expert assesses your dental health and reviews your objectives. the best orthodontist near me might take X-rays or scans to ensure you're an appropriate prospect for implants.
When you're approved, the initial step of the treatment includes putting the titanium dental implant right into your jawbone. This is done under neighborhood anesthesia, so you won't really feel pain throughout the process.
After the dental implant is put, it's important to enable a healing duration of a few months. Throughout this time around, the implant integrates with your bone-- a procedure known as osseointegration.
After recovery, you'll return to the dental professional to affix a joint, which acts as a port between the dental implant and the crown. As soon as the joint is protected, perceptions of your mouth will be required to create a custom crown that matches your all-natural teeth.
Lastly, when your crown prepares, your dentist will certainly connect it to the abutment. The entire procedure might take numerous months, however the result is a durable, natural-looking tooth that can dramatically improve your quality of life.
